Dr Steve Tiesdell (1964-2011)

Sat, 10 Sep 2011 14:37:25 BST

Dr Steve Tiesdell, Senior Lecturer in Public Policy at the University of Glasgow and one of the UK’s leading academic urban designers, died on 30 June 2011, aged 47.
